#37d572 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#37d572 is composed of 21.6% red, 83.5% green and 44.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 74.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 46.5%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 142.4 degrees, a saturation of 65.3% and a lightness of 52.5%. #37d572 color hex could be obtained by blending #6effe4 with #00ab00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

Shades and Tints of #37d572
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020b05 is the darkest color, while #fafefb is the lightest one.
